Congress can check the power of the federal judiciary in all of the following ways except:a. confirming or not confirming nominees.b. changing the number of judges.c. initiating amendments to the Constitution.d. interpreting laws themselves.e. deciding the jurisdiction of lower courts

Answers

Answer 1

Congress can check the power of the federal judiciary in all of the following ways except interpreting laws themselves. (Option D)

While Congress has the power to confirm or not confirm nominees, change the number of judges, initiate amendments to the Constitution, and decide the jurisdiction of lower courts, it is not within their authority to directly interpret laws themselves. The power of interpreting laws is primarily vested in the judicial branch, specifically the federal courts, including the Supreme Court.

The role of Congress is to pass legislation, and it is the judiciary's responsibility to interpret and apply those laws in cases brought before them. This separation of powers ensures a system of checks and balances, where each branch has distinct roles and limits on their authority to prevent concentration of power.

one of the problems with intercultural communication is that senders encode messages based on their own cultures, and receivers decode messages based on their cultures.

Answers

One of the problems with intercultural communication is the cultural encoding and decoding of messages. In intercultural interactions, individuals from different culture have distinct sets of values, beliefs, norms, and communication styles.

As a result, senders encode culture based on their own cultural background, and receivers decode messages based on their cultural perspectives. This can lead to misunderstandings, misinterpretations, and communication barriers.

When senders encode messages, they rely on their cultural assumptions and patterns of communication. They may use language, non-verbal cues, and references that are familiar and meaningful within their own cultural context. However, receivers from different cultures may not share the same cultural references or interpret the messages in the same way. They may have different linguistic abilities, non-verbal communication norms, and cultural filters through which they interpret the messages.

These differences in encoding and decoding can result in various communication challenges, including:

1. Language barriers: Different languages and dialects can lead to misunderstandings and misinterpretations of intended messages.

2. Non-verbal communication: Non-verbal cues such as gestures, facial expressions, and body language can be interpreted differently across cultures, leading to confusion or miscommunication.

3. Cultural context and references: Cultural values, norms, and references may be unknown or have different meanings to the receiver, affecting message comprehension.

4. Communication styles: Directness, politeness, and formality vary across cultures, leading to different expectations and perceptions of communication.

To mitigate these challenges, individuals engaging in intercultural communication can develop cultural competence, which involves understanding and appreciating cultural differences, being mindful of potential biases, and using effective communication strategies that bridge cultural gaps.

Barthes believed that mythic signs reinforce the dominant values of their culture. True/False

Answers

True. Barthes argued that mythic signs, such as advertising, reinforce the dominant values and beliefs of a culture by naturalizing them and making them seem inevitable and unquestionable.

Roland Barthes, a prominent French semiotician and cultural theorist, argued that mythic signs, particularly those found in popular culture and media, serve to reinforce and perpetuate the dominant values, ideologies, and beliefs of a given culture. According to Barthes, these signs are not simply innocent or natural, but are carefully constructed and encoded with meaning that reflects and supports the cultural norms and power structures. He believed that through the process of myth-making, everyday objects, ideas, and practices are transformed into powerful symbols that shape our understanding of the world and serve the interests of those in power.

Adbul has just discovered his term paper is due tomorrow when he thought it was due next week. According to Hans Selye, Abdul is MOST likely experiencing the stage of the general adaptation syndrome.
a. appraisal
b. exhaustion
c. alarm
d. resistance

Answers

Adbul has just discovered his term paper is due tomorrow when he thought it was due next week. According to Hans Selye, Abdul is MOST likely experiencing the stage of the general adaptation syndrome. The correct answer is c. alarm.

According to Hans Selye's general adaptation syndrome, when an individual is faced with a stressor, they first experience the alarm stage, where their body goes into a fight or flight response. In Abdul's case, discovering that his term paper is due tomorrow when he thought it was due next week would trigger this response, making him feel anxious and overwhelmed.

In the alarm stage, an individual's immediate reaction to a stressor triggers the body's "fight-or-flight" response. This response prepares the body for a potential threat or challenge by activating the sympathetic nervous system and releasing stress hormones like adrenaline and cortisol. In Abdul's case, upon discovering the shortened deadline for his term paper, he would likely experience a sudden rush of stress, heightened awareness, and increased arousal as his body initiates the alarm response.

The resistance stage follows the alarm stage, during which the body tries to adapt and cope with the stressor. It involves ongoing efforts to manage the stress and regain balance. The exhaustion stage occurs when the body's resources become depleted due to prolonged or chronic stress, leading to physical and mental exhaustion.

Abdul has just discovered the unexpected deadline, he is likely in the initial stage of alarm, where his body and mind are responding to the immediate stress of the situation.

Correct option is c. alarm.

in her investment model of close relationships, what does rusbult (1983) define as an investment?

Answers

In Rusbult's (1983) investment model of close relationships, an investment is anything that an individual has put into the relationship that would be lost if the relationship were to end.

This includes not only tangible things like time, money, and resources, but also intangible things like emotional energy, self-disclosure, and shared experiences. Rusbult argues that the more an individual has invested in a relationship, the more committed they are likely to be to maintaining it, even in the face of difficulties or challenges.

schizoaffective disorder has symptoms typical of both schizophrenia and which type of disorder?

Answers

Schizoaffective disorder is characterized by symptoms that are typical of both schizophrenia and mood disorders, such as bipolar disorder or major depressive disorder. It is a complex mental health condition that combines symptoms of schizophrenia with those of a mood disorder.

Schizoaffective disorder is a mental illness that shares symptoms of both schizophrenia and mood disorders, such as depression or bipolar disorder. Individuals with schizoaffective disorder experience a combination of symptoms related to psychosis, such as delusions, hallucinations, disordered thinking, and disorganized behavior, as well as mood symptoms, such as mania or depression. The specific symptoms and their severity can vary from person to person and can change over time, making the diagnosis and treatment of schizoaffective disorder challenging.

Schizoaffective disorder is a complex mental illness that is still not well understood. The exact causes are not known, but researchers believe that genetics, environmental factors, and brain chemistry all play a role in its development. Treatment typically involves a combination of medication and therapy, which can help manage the symptoms and improve overall functioning. While the prognosis for schizoaffective disorder can vary, with proper treatment and support, many individuals with this condition are able to lead fulfilling and productive lives.

andrea smith argues that anti-black racism, genocide, and orientalism are the three pillars of:

Answers

In her work, Smith argues that anti-black racism, genocide, and orientalism are the three pillars of white supremacy in the United States.

By this, she means that these three interrelated forms of oppression work together to maintain the dominance of white people over people of color anti-black racism refers to the systemic and institutionalized discrimination against black people in the United States. This form of racism is deeply rooted in the country's history of slavery, segregation, and discrimination. Genocide, on the other hand, refers to the deliberate and systematic destruction of entire groups of people, often through violence or forced displacement. This has been a longstanding issue for Indigenous peoples in the United States who have faced genocide through colonization, land dispossession, forced assimilation, and other forms of violence.

Finally, orientalism is a term coined by scholar Edward Said to describe the ways in which the West has constructed a stereotypical and exoticized image of the East. This form of racism reinforces the idea that people from non-Western cultures are inferior and uncivilized, and it has been used to justify colonization, imperialism, and war. In the United States, orientalism has been used to demonize Muslims and other groups from the Middle East and South Asia.

__________ memory refers to how many items you are able to understand and remember at one time.

Answers

The term that refers to how many items you are able to understand and remember at one time is "working memory." Working memory is a cognitive system responsible for temporarily holding and manipulating information during complex cognitive tasks.

It is often described as the mental workspace where information is actively processed.

Working memory involves the simultaneous storage and manipulation of information, allowing individuals to engage in activities such as problem-solving, reasoning, decision-making, and language comprehension. It plays a crucial role in various cognitive processes, including learning, attention, and executive functions.

The capacity of working memory varies among individuals but is generally limited. Research suggests that the average adult can hold around 5 to 9 items (known as "chunks") of information in working memory at one time. However, the capacity can be influenced by factors such as complexity, familiarity, and individual differences.

Working memory is distinct from long-term memory, which is responsible for the storage and retrieval of information over a more extended period. Working memory is the cognitive system that allows us to actively work with information in the present moment, making it essential for everyday cognitive tasks.

What was true of jefferson’s contradictory nature?

Answers

Thomas Jefferson, the third President of the United States, was known for his contradictory nature in various aspects of his life and political beliefs. One of the key contradictions associated with Jefferson was his stance on slavery.

While he expressed strong ideals of liberty and equality, as reflected in the Declaration of Independence, he also owned slaves and benefited economically from the institution of slavery. This contradiction between his belief in individual rights and his personal involvement in slaveholding highlights the complexity of Jefferson's character. Another area of contradiction was his view on states' rights versus a strong central government.

Jefferson advocated for limited federal power and championed states' rights, yet as president, he sometimes exercised strong executive authority, such as with the Louisiana Purchase, which expanded federal power and territory.Jefferson's contradictory nature also extended to his views on agrarianism and industrialization. He believed in an agrarian society and the virtues of agriculture, yet he supported the growth of industry and technological progress, including advancements in manufacturing and transportation.
